About The Position

Our Technician is responsible for performing high-quality maintenance and repairs on medium and heavy-duty vehicles. This role ensures safety, customer satisfaction, and efficient operations by following established repair procedures and maintaining a clean and organized workspace.

Requirements

  • Maintain up-to-date knowledge of vehicle maintenance and repair practices, applying this understanding to daily tasks.
  • Apply knowledge of International’s repair and maintenance procedures , including troubleshooting techniques, technical vehicle systems, tools, and documentation.
  • Communicate clearly and respectfully with team members, leadership, and customers to promote understanding, build trust, and encourage open dialogue.
  • Effectively plan and organize daily tasks by setting clear priorities and using available resources to meet goals that support overall team and organizational success.
  • Uphold and promote a safe, healthy, and compliant work environment by following and reinforcing safety policies, procedures, and regulations.
  • Utilize software systems and digital tools effectively to perform job-related tasks, streamline workflows, and support accurate, efficient service delivery.
  • Medium or heavy-duty technician, equivalent experience or qualification
  • High school diploma or general education degree (GED)
  • Applicable certifications related to industry, products, and/or safety
  • Valid driver's license is required; currently maintains or can obtain a Commercial Driver’s License (CDL)

Responsibilities

  • Conduct routine inspections and diagnostics to vehicles and equipment.
  • Read job orders, observe and listen to vehicles in operation to determine malfunction, and plan work procedures.
  • Examine protective guards, loose bolts, and specified safety devices on trucks - making adjustments as needed.
  • Tag all warranty parts and returns to the warranty clerk.
  • Maintain accurate records of all maintenance and repair work performed.
  • Collaborate with team members to troubleshoot complex mechanical issues.
  • Operate forklifts as needed for moving parts and equipment within the shop.
  • Attend training classes and keep abreast of factory technical bulletins.
  • Develop and maintain positive relationships with customers to increase overall customer satisfaction.
  • Mentor coworkers and apprentices through hands-on coaching, knowledge sharing, and guidance to encourage skill growth and team success.
  • Take ownership of challenges and opportunities by addressing issues promptly, finding practical solutions, and continually seeking process improvements.
